Mission

Ctul is a worker-led organization where workers organize, educate and empower each other to fight for a voice in their workplaces and in their communities. We partner with other organizations and leaders to build a movement to win racial, gender and economic justice. We identify the root causes of injustice and work to shift the balance of power between those who have it and those who don't to improve the lives of our communities for present and future generations.

Programs

2 programs

This program delivers workers' rights education and other educational content regarding civic engagement, public speaking, and organizing for equitable social change to workers employed in the amenities sectors of downtown minneapolis, minnesota. In 2024 this program delivered one or more these services to 176 people, all of them low-wage workers and the majority of them from underserved communities.

This program delivers workers' rights education and other educational content regarding civic engagement, public speaking, and organizing for equitable social change. In 2024 this program delivered one or more these services to 355 people, all of them low-wage construction workers from underserved communities.
